| /**
 | |
|  * Timer_clock1: Prescaler   2 ->  36    MHz
 | |
|  * Timer_clock2: Prescaler   8 ->   9    MHz
 | |
|  * Timer_clock3: Prescaler  32 ->   2.25 MHz
 | |
|  * Timer_clock4: Prescaler 128 -> 562.5  kHz
 | |
|  */

| void HAL_timer_start(const uint8_t timer_num, const uint32_t frequency) {
 | |
|   nvic_irq_num irq_num;
 | |
|   switch (timer_num) {
 | |
|     case 1: irq_num = NVIC_TIMER1_CC; break;
 | |
|     case 2: irq_num = NVIC_TIMER2; break;
 | |
|     case 3: irq_num = NVIC_TIMER3; break;
 | |
|     case 4: irq_num = NVIC_TIMER4; break;
 | |
|     case 5: irq_num = NVIC_TIMER5; break;
 | |
|     default:
 | |
|       /**
 | |
|        *  We should not get here, add Sanitycheck for timer number. Should be a general timer
 | |
|        *  since basic timers do not have CC channels.
 | |
|        *  Advanced timers should be skipped if possible too, and are not listed above.
 | |
|        */
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|   }
 | |
|   nvic_irq_set_priority(irq_num, 0xF); // this is the lowest settable priority, but should still be over USB
 | |
| 
 | |
|   switch (timer_num) {
 | |
|     case STEP_TIMER_NUM:
 | |
|       timer_pause(STEP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       timer_set_count(STEP_TIMER_DEV, 0);
 | |
|       timer_set_prescaler(STEP_TIMER_DEV, (uint16)(STEPPER_TIMER_PRESCALE - 1));
 | |
|       timer_set_reload(STEP_TIMER_DEV, 0xFFFF);
 | |
|       timer_set_compare(STEP_TIMER_DEV, STEP_TIMER_CHAN, min(HAL_TIMER_TYPE_MAX, (HAL_STEPPER_TIMER_RATE / frequency)));
 | |
|       timer_attach_interrupt(STEP_TIMER_DEV, STEP_TIMER_CHAN, stepTC_Handler);
 | |
|       timer_generate_update(STEP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       timer_resume(STEP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|     case TEMP_TIMER_NUM:
 | |
|       timer_pause(TEMP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       timer_set_count(TEMP_TIMER_DEV, 0);
 | |
|       timer_set_prescaler(TEMP_TIMER_DEV, (uint16)(TEMP_TIMER_PRESCALE - 1));
 | |
|       timer_set_reload(TEMP_TIMER_DEV, 0xFFFF);
 | |
|       timer_set_compare(TEMP_TIMER_DEV, TEMP_TIMER_CHAN, min(HAL_TIMER_TYPE_MAX, ((F_CPU / TEMP_TIMER_PRESCALE) / frequency)));
 | |
|       timer_attach_interrupt(TEMP_TIMER_DEV, TEMP_TIMER_CHAN, tempTC_Handler);
 | |
|       timer_generate_update(TEMP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       timer_resume(TEMP_TIMER_DEV);
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|   }
 | |
| }
